Moving to Goodyear, AZ from Chicago, IL

Goodyear, Arizona, has quickly become one of the most popular destinations for Chicagoans leaving the Midwest. Located in the West Valley of the Phoenix metro area in Maricopa County, Goodyear sits roughly 17 miles west of downtown Phoenix and offers something Chicago cannot: more than 300 sunny days a year, year-round outdoor living, lower state income taxes, and master-planned communities like Estrella, PebbleCreek, and Palm Valley. With a population of more than 108,000 and steady growth fueled by Fortune 500 employers including Amazon, Boeing, Microsoft, Chewy, Ball, and United Airlines, Goodyear has evolved from a quiet farming town into one of Arizona’s fastest-growing cities.

Relocating from Chicago to Goodyear is a long-distance move of roughly 1,750 miles, and that distance changes how you plan, pack, and budget. You are leaving behind lake-effect winters, high property taxes, and the 10.25% Chicago sales tax for a desert climate, lower cost-of-living essentials, and access to the Loop 303, I-10 freeway,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port, and Goodyear Ballpark, the spring training home of the Cleveland Guardians and Cincinnati Reds. Why Chicagoans Are Moving to Goodyear

The Chicago-to-Goodyear pipeline has grown sharply in the last five years. The reasons are consistent across remote workers, retirees, and families.

  • Warm, desert climate with mild winters in the 60s and 70s
  • Arizona’s flat 2.5% state income tax versus Illinois’s 4.95%
  • Newer single-family housing stock at a lower price per square foot
  • Strong job market in tech, aerospace, logistics, and healthcare
  • Master-planned communities such as Estrella, PebbleCreek, and Canyon Trails
  • Quick access to Sky Harbor Airport, Loop 303, and I-10
  • Lower property taxes compared to Cook County
  • Year-round access to hiking at Estrella Mountain Regional Park and the White Tank Mountains

Chicago to Goodyear: Distance, Drive Time, and Move Duration

Goodyear is approximately 1,750 miles from Chicago by road. The most common route takes you down I-55, then west on I-44 through Missouri and Oklahoma, and onto I-40 across New Mexico into Arizona before connecting to I-10 west into Goodyear.

DetailEstimate
Total distance~1,750 miles
Driving time (non-stop)25–27 hours
Typical 3-day drive8–9 hours per day
Full-service mover delivery window5–12 days
Car shipping time5–7 days

Cost of Moving From Chicago to Goodyear

Costs depend on home size, packing services, season, and add-ons such as auto transport. The summer months are the busiest and the most expensive.

Home SizeEstimated Cost
Studio / 1-Bedroom$2,500 – $4,800
2-Bedroom$4,500 – $7,500
3-Bedroom$6,800 – $10,500
4-Bedroom$9,500 – $12,800
Car shipping (sedan, open carrier)$900 – $1,400

Booking 6 to 8 weeks ahead generally locks in better pricing. Moving in spring (March–May) or fall (September–November) typically saves 15% to 25% versus peak summer rates.

Chicago vs Goodyear: A Quick Lifestyle Comparison

FactorChicago, ILGoodyear, AZ
Population~2.7 million~108,000
Climate4 seasons, cold wintersSunny, dry, mild winters
State income tax4.95% flat2.5% flat
Sales tax (city)10.25%8.8%
Median home price$310,000 – $360,000~$468,000
Median rent (apt)$1,900 – $2,400~$1,628
Top employersFinance, healthcare, logisticsAmazon, Boeing, Microsoft, Chewy
Outdoor lifestyleLakefront, parksDesert hiking, golf, year-round outdoors

Best Neighborhoods in Goodyear for Chicago New Movers

Estrella

Estrella is one of Goodyear’s flagship master-planned communities, featuring 65 miles of trails, 72 acres of lakes, a yacht club, golf, and newer single-family homes. It is a strong fit for families and remote workers leaving the Chicago suburbs.

PebbleCreek

PebbleCreek is a 55-plus active-adult community with two golf courses, tennis courts, and a tight-knit social scene, popular with retirees relocating from Cook and DuPage Counties.

Palm Valley

Palm Valley offers established single-family homes, top-rated schools, easy I-10 access, and is one of Goodyear’s most family-friendly areas. Households used to neighborhoods like Park Ridge or Arlington Heights often find Palm Valley familiar.

Canyon Trails

Canyon Trails is a newer development on the south side of Goodyear with affordable single-family homes, walking trails, and growing retail. It appeals to first-time buyers and young families.

GSQ (Downtown Goodyear)

GSQ is Goodyear’s emerging downtown core, with new office space, restaurants, and walkable amenities along Goodyear Boulevard. Ideal for young professionals coming from neighborhoods like Lincoln Park or Logan Square.

Jobs and the Goodyear Economy

Goodyear has become a regional employment hub. Major employers include Amazon (multiple fulfillment centers), Boeing, Microsoft (Goodyear data centers), Chewy, Ball Corporation, and United Airlines. Phoenix Goodyear Airport supports aviation and aerospace jobs, and the broader Phoenix metro adds access to healthcare giants like Banner Health and tech firms across the Valley. Many Chicago professionals find roles in logistics, technology, aviation, healthcare, and real estate within a 30-minute drive of Goodyear.

What to Do Before Moving Day

A long-distance move from Chicago to Goodyear works best when planned 8 to 10 weeks out.

8–10 weeks before:

  • Request written estimates from licensed long-distance movers with valid USDOT and MC numbers
  • Decide whether to ship your vehicle or drive it across
  • Research Goodyear neighborhoods, school districts, and HOAs

4–6 weeks before:

  • Confirm moving company, dates, and contract
  • Begin downsizing items you do not need in a desert climate
  • Notify your employer, schools, and key contacts

1–2 weeks before:

  • Forward mail through USPS
  • Transfer utilities, internet, and HOA paperwork
  • Update your address with banks, insurers, and the IRS
  • Secure parking permits or elevator reservations if leaving a Chicago high-rise

What Changes After You Move to Goodyear

  • You have 30 days to obtain an Arizona driver’s license and register your vehicle with the Arizona MVD
  • Arizona vehicle registration uses the Vehicle License Tax (VLT) based on the assessed value of your vehicle
  • Summer temperatures regularly exceed 110°F, so HVAC quality matters more than in Chicago
  • Home cooling costs typically run higher than Chicago heating bills
  • Most daily life in Goodyear requires a car, with limited public transit options
  • HOA fees are common in master-planned communities like Estrella and PebbleCreek

Packing Tips for a Chicago to Goodyear Move

Belongings making the 1,750-mile trip through the Midwest and Sonoran Desert need extra protection.

  • Use double-walled boxes for fragile items
  • Wrap electronics and artwork in bubble wrap and corrugated cardboard
  • Avoid packing liquids, candles, or aerosols that can rupture in desert heat
  • Disassemble large furniture and label all hardware
  • Pack an essentials kit for the 3 to 5 day drive
  • Photograph valuable items before they are loaded onto the truck
